Position Summary

Under general direction, provides organizational leadership in the development, implementation and maintenance of service consistent with the Mission, Vision, Values and Strategic Plan of the Mary Greeley Medical Center. Leader understands, supports, communicates, and promotes hospital initiatives. Ensures all actions taken in carrying out responsibilities support patient centered care and a respectful work environment.

Safety Expectations

Lead safety efforts by ensuring staff receive timely education and updates on organizational safety goals, evidence-based practices, regulations, and requirements; fostering a culture of trust where staff feel comfortable bringing concerns forward; promptly addressing identified safety concerns and serious safety events through established escalation pathways; completing A3/Root Cause Analyses with timely follow-up and applying fair, consistent accountability when evaluating and addressing events and concerns.

Key Responsibilities

Instill a culture of customer service by emphasizing responsiveness, resourcefulness, follow-through, accuracy, timeliness and accountability.

Coordinates unit shared decision-making teams; ensures effective utilization of meeting time and that meeting minutes are documented.

Creates ownership in decision-making processes by collaborating with others to identify problems, develop solutions, and implements and monitors effectiveness of solutions.

Implements, revises, communicate and monitor compliance with organizational and specific policies and clinical guidelines for safe patient care delivery.

Accountable for attendance, participation and dissemination of information from organization and nursing department meetings.

Participates in the medical centers’ Quality Improvement plan by gathering and analyzing data associated with continuous improvement of care and services, and monitoring quality control programs.

Acts as a department resource for unit-specific core competencies.

Required Education, Licensure, Certification, Experience

Minimum of two years experience.

Mandatory Reporter training within 90 days of hire and must maintain throughout employment.

Current Iowa license as a Registered Nurse

BSN with two years clinical experience.

Preferred Education, Licensure, Certification, Experience

Masters level of education in nursing or health related field.

Professional certification in nursing specialty or nursing leadership within 24 months of hire. If currently enrolled in master’s program, the certification will need to be completed within 24 months of graduation.
